Best Easy Hikes for Beginners

Makapu’u Lighthouse Trail

The Makapu’u Lighthouse Trail is one of the most accessible hikes on Oahu. This paved trail offers breathtaking views of the Pacific Ocean, making it an excellent option for families and beginners. Along the hike, you’ll see Makapu’u Point Lighthouse, a historic landmark that has guided ships for over a century. If you visit during the winter months, you may even spot migrating humpback whales from the viewing platforms.

Manoa Falls Trail

The Manoa Falls Trail is an easy hike that takes you through a lush rainforest, leading to a stunning waterfall. Located near Honolulu, this hike is perfect for those looking to experience the tropical beauty of Hawaii without much effort. The trail is often shaded by towering bamboo and tropical plants, making it a cool and refreshing hike. At the end of the trail, hikers are rewarded with a spectacular view of Manoa Falls, which cascades down a rocky cliff into a serene pool below.

Moderate Hikes with Rewarding Views

Diamond Head Crater

Diamond Head Crater is one of the most famous hikes on Oahu, attracting thousands of visitors each year. The hike is moderately challenging, involving a series of switchbacks and staircases leading to the summit. Once at the top, hikers are rewarded with panoramic views of Waikiki, Honolulu, and the vast Pacific Ocean. It’s best to start this hike early in the morning to avoid the midday heat and large crowds.

Koko Crater Stairs

For those seeking a workout with a rewarding view, the Koko Crater Stairs hike is an excellent choice. This hike consists of over 1,000 railroad-tie steps leading to the summit of Koko Head. It’s a steep and strenuous climb, but the breathtaking views of the east side of Oahu make it worth the effort. This hike is best attempted in the early morning or late afternoon to avoid extreme heat.

Advanced Hikes for Adventure Seekers

Ka’au Crater Trail

Ka’au Crater Trail is one of the most adventurous hikes in Oahu, featuring waterfalls, ridge-line walking, and rope-assisted climbs. This hike is challenging and requires endurance, but the stunning views of the crater and surrounding landscapes make it one of the best trails on the island. Along the trail, hikers will encounter several waterfalls, providing a perfect spot to rest and enjoy the natural beauty of Oahu.

Stairway to Heaven (Haiku Stairs – Legal Route via Moanalua)

The legendary Stairway to Heaven, also known as the Haiku Stairs, is one of the most talked-about hikes in Hawaii. While the original Haiku Stairs route is illegal, there is a legal alternative through the Moanalua Valley Trail. This challenging hike offers breathtaking ridge-line views and a sense of adventure unmatched by other trails. The climb is steep and requires proper preparation, but those who complete it are rewarded with some of the best views of Oahu.

Hikes with Unique Experiences

Lanikai Pillbox Hike (Ka’iwa Ridge Trail)

The Lanikai Pillbox Hike is a short yet rewarding trail that leads to two historic military bunkers overlooking Lanikai Beach. This hike is known for its breathtaking sunrise views, making it a popular choice for early-morning hikers. The turquoise waters of Lanikai Beach and the Mokulua Islands provide a stunning backdrop, making this one of the most scenic hikes on Oahu.

Waimea Valley Trail

The Waimea Valley Trail is a unique hike that combines cultural history with natural beauty. This hike takes visitors through botanical gardens, ancient Hawaiian archaeological sites, and ends at Waimea Falls, where visitors can take a refreshing swim. This is a great hike for families and those interested in learning more about Hawaii’s history while enjoying a relaxing nature walk.

Tips for Hiking Safely in Oahu

Hiking in Oahu can be an incredible experience, but it’s important to be prepared. Always bring plenty of water, wear sunscreen, and dress appropriately for the terrain. Respect the natural environment by staying on designated trails and not leaving any trash behind. Check weather conditions before heading out, as sudden rain can make some trails dangerous and slippery. If hiking alone, inform someone of your plans before starting the hike.
